How Pat Carney's Innings Pitched Compares to Similar Players

Pat Carney totaled 109 career Innings Pitched, well below the league average of 586.1 — production that significantly underperformed against league baselines. Across 3 seasons, the Innings Pitched arc showed a disappointing start, with limited data making longer-term conclusions premature. With 3 seasons of data, the Innings Pitched arc was below league norms — too limited for reliable trend analysis. Significant season-to-season variance characterizes the Innings Pitched profile — ranging from 5 to 78 — though the career average remained well below league norms.
